Exactly How Do fidelity Bonds Work?



When you purchase a fidelity bond, you're essentially buying a policy that supplies financial security versus certain acts of employee deceit.



These bonds cover losses brought on by theft, scams, or various other wrongful acts dedicated by your staff members. To begin, you'll require to select the bond amount, which commonly shows the possible threat your organization deals with.

When you have actually bought the bond, it functions as a warranty that the insurer will certainly compensate you for any type of protected losses approximately the bond restriction.

If an unethical act occurs, you'll sue with the bonding company, supplying necessary proof. The insurance firm will certainly after that check out the insurance claim and, if valid, compensate you for your losses, assisting safeguard your service's financial health and wellness.
